Transaction 17e704daac14d142ca613c86f9a3caf87f401ad7a4589b49b884aa4e563ceda3

1 Input
2 Outputs
  • 17e704daac14d142ca613c86f9a3caf87f401ad7a4589b49b884aa4e563ceda3:0
  • value  4000000
    address  1KX35pJJ29pUUVCUBY7ufqzCb63x4RkPkV
  • 17e704daac14d142ca613c86f9a3caf87f401ad7a4589b49b884aa4e563ceda3:1
  • value  8976415
    address  1L1w7LrRcNWCxEN9Gt1PcGezFPwaEagKRC